This morning I noticed my female kitten's right eye looks a bit cloudy. She seems to squint a little bit with that eye, and the other eye seems normal. Dilation and all that seems fine as well. Any ideas? IP: Logged |

Sounds like an infection. Try bathing it with salt water every couple of hours (luke-warm,about 1/4 teaspoon to a cup) with cottonwool. If it gets worse or doesn't respond after 24 hours see a vet. Eye infections can be serious. IP: Logged |

Agree that it sounds like an infection. Lots of cat eye problems generate from the herpes virus, and which reoccur from time to time. Have to see vet for particular antibiotic that must be used which is not available over the counter to us in catalog. God bless. IP: Logged |
